Swift News - Apple Intelligence, WWDC 24, Swift Testing, SwiftUI & More

  Рет қаралды 9,494

Sean Allen

Sean Allen

Күн бұрын

Go to squarespace.com/seanallen to save 10% off your first purchase of a website or domain using code SEANALLEN.
Swift News is a monthly show where I break down the latest happenings in the world of Swift, SwiftUI and iOS development. In this episode I cover:
- Apple Intelligence
- What's New in SwiftUI
- Swift Testing
- SF Symbols 6
- What's New in UIKit
- Apple's WWDC Guides
- Apple Design Award Winners
- History of SwiftUI
- Product Evolution over a Decade
- Visual Hierarchy Design Tip
All Links are kept here -Swift News GitHub Repo:
github.com/SAllen0400/swift-news
My iOS Dev Courses:
seanallen.teachable.com/
My Source Code:
seanallen.teachable.com/p/sou...
X (Twitter):
Sean Allen - / seanallen_dev
Hired.com:
hired.com/x/1n01g
Book and learning recommendations that help out the channel if you decide to purchase (Affiliate Links):
Mark Moeyken’s SwiftUI Books:
www.bigmountainstudio.com/a/f...
Paul Hudson's Hacking With Swift:
gumroad.com/a/762098803
RocketSim - Enhance Your Xcode Simulator:
gumroad.com/a/51797971/ftvbh
Objc.io Books (Thinking in SwiftUI & Advanced Swift):
gumroad.com/a/656585843
Timestamps:
0:00 - Apple Intelligence
2:07 - What's New in SwiftUI
4:14 - Swift Testing
5:03 - SF Symbols 6
6:08 - What's New in UIKit
7:47 - Apple's WWDC Guides
9:37 - Apple Design Award Winners
10:38 - History of SwiftUI
12:19 - Product Evolution over a Decade
13:53 - Visual Hierarchy Design Tip
#swift #softwaredeveloper #iosdeveloper

Пікірлер: 28
@seanallen
@seanallen Ай бұрын
Learn more with my iOS Dev courses at seanallen.teachable.com
@SanusiAdewale
@SanusiAdewale Ай бұрын
I remember when swift charts launch, a friend of mine was in tears because it launched 3 days after he painfully completed a UIKit project which had charts in it , getting its data from a raspberry 😂😂
@seanallen
@seanallen Ай бұрын
Bummer for your friend, but Swift charts is amazing!
@karansarin1986
@karansarin1986 Ай бұрын
SF SYMBOLS are my favorite thing too! 😄
@DaveJacobseniOS
@DaveJacobseniOS Ай бұрын
Thank you Sean!
@seanallen
@seanallen Ай бұрын
No problem, Dave :)
@vamsi3877
@vamsi3877 27 күн бұрын
Thanks Sean 👏
@seanallen
@seanallen 23 күн бұрын
No worries
@codekids99
@codekids99 Ай бұрын
Keep it up 🎉
@seanallen
@seanallen Ай бұрын
Will do
@randomjjj4034
@randomjjj4034 Ай бұрын
🔥🔥🔥
@ToddHoff
@ToddHoff Ай бұрын
People who don’t have a lot of multi threading experience may not realize just dumping everything on a mainactor thread has large implications for latency and responsiveness. It’s easy to block threads by accident. I’m curious how all this will work out.
@SanusiAdewale
@SanusiAdewale Ай бұрын
are there resources to learn more about multi threading and performance? I was shocked when I realised a side project was using 468MB of RAM, all it did was get data from an api and display it
@darylewalker6862
@darylewalker6862 Ай бұрын
I think the expectation is that anything not part of the UI should be done on another thread
@aronianspigonian8589
@aronianspigonian8589 26 күн бұрын
@@SanusiAdewalelet me know if you find anything too :( all I know is that UI changes go on the main thread and everything else doesn’t get priority as far as I know
@SanusiAdewale
@SanusiAdewale 23 күн бұрын
@@aronianspigonian8589 I will
@Notkdenben
@Notkdenben Ай бұрын
Has anyone seen how to do the dark mode icons? I haven’t had any luck making that work
@mimisbrunnur
@mimisbrunnur Ай бұрын
It’s currently in Develop beta(only works with Apple’s own apps rn) , will be in the upcoming public beta, official release in September presumably
@riken2567
@riken2567 Ай бұрын
it's 2024 should i go for Uikit or swiftui
@Twimmy15
@Twimmy15 Ай бұрын
If you want to be able to work on legacy codebases, learn both. There are still a lot of apps that have not been ported to SwiftUI
@riken2567
@riken2567 Ай бұрын
@@Twimmy15 thanks brother can you guide me more
@TheiTE
@TheiTE 29 күн бұрын
@@riken2567 I think the general recommendation is, if you want a job *today*, then learn UIKit, but if you want to build your own apps from scratch, then SwiftUI is the way to go. SwiftUI will also help you build for all platforms from watchOS, iOS, visionOS to macOS.
@iLoveAppl3947
@iLoveAppl3947 28 күн бұрын
swiftui for your projects. If you need a job in the industry then you need both to pass interviews. 4 out of 5 job adverts are requiring UIKit
@otkwass
@otkwass Ай бұрын
still no new objective-c version... :(
@codecungintern
@codecungintern Ай бұрын
Sadly… objc still be something different that make me feel like I’m getting more power
@theiosdeveloper555
@theiosdeveloper555 Ай бұрын
1st
@sewing848
@sewing848 Ай бұрын
"Apple Intelligence" is eerily Orwellian
iOS 18.1 - Apple Intelligence is INSANE! (20+ New Features)
12:10
Brandon Butch
Рет қаралды 158 М.
НЫСАНА КОНЦЕРТ 2024
2:26:34
Нысана театры
Рет қаралды 1,3 МЛН
EVOLUTION OF ICE CREAM 😱 #shorts
00:11
Savage Vlogs
Рет қаралды 8 МЛН
Steve Wozniak Reacts to Apple's New AI Tools
4:47
Bloomberg Television
Рет қаралды 281 М.
The Real Reason Why Music Is Getting Worse
12:42
Rick Beato
Рет қаралды 2,9 МЛН
Why SwiftUI developers aren't learning UIKit
11:24
codingKo
Рет қаралды 677
You Need to Document Your Swift Code with DocC
10:52
Sean Allen
Рет қаралды 6 М.
Your Mac will NEVER be the same!
10:36
ZONEofTECH
Рет қаралды 389 М.
Your App Will Get Rejected | New Privacy Rules - 2024
11:26
Sean Allen
Рет қаралды 35 М.
5 Design Patterns That Are ACTUALLY Used By Developers
9:27
Alex Hyett
Рет қаралды 232 М.
Google Reacts to iOS 18
2:47
SAMTIME
Рет қаралды 436 М.
iOS Dev Career Advice
1:09:48
Sean Allen
Рет қаралды 17 М.
КРУТОЙ ТЕЛЕФОН
0:16
KINO KAIF
Рет қаралды 6 МЛН
iPhone 16 с инновационным аккумулятором
0:45
ÉЖИ АКСЁНОВ
Рет қаралды 10 МЛН
iPhone socket cleaning #Fixit
0:30
Tamar DB (mt)
Рет қаралды 17 МЛН